Choosing the Starting Zone
When creating a new game session on your server, you can select your starting area via the Create Game tab.
Four main zones are available for players:
- 🌱 Grass Fields — Ideal for beginners: Satisfactory's primary starting area, featuring flat terrain that makes building and starting out easy. However, basic resources are further apart and sometimes require early transportation setups.
- 🪨 Rocky Desert — Adapted to new players: A well-balanced zone regarding building space and resource nodes. It offers a great compromise between accessibility and variety, with nearby water for your early industrial setup.
- 🌲 Northern Forest — For experienced players: An area extremely rich in mineral resources, characterized by very complex terrain. The heavy elevation changes require careful planning.
- 🏜️ Dune Desert — Recommended for experts: A massive open area packed with high-quality resources. The initial scarcity of water and vegetation makes the early game much more challenging and demanding.
Once your zone is selected, enter a session name in the dedicated field, then click on the Create Game button.
Modifying the Zone After Creation
If you have already launched your game on Satisfactory and want to change regions, two options are available:
1. Create a new session
The simplest and cleanest method is to recreate a new session directly via the server manager by selecting a different starting zone.
2. Move your HUB
You can also choose to manually move your existing HUB in-game. The HUB acts as the central point of your progression and can be freely repositioned elsewhere on the map if you decide to relocate your facilities.
Troubleshooting
❌ Unable to start the game after selecting the zone
- Version verification: Ensure that both your game and the server are running on the exact same version. Restart the server from your panel if an update was just deployed.
- Invalid session name: Avoid using special characters or accents in the session name, as this can block the initial map generation.
Best Practices
A few tips for choosing your first location wisely.
- Start with the Grass Fields if you are discovering the game for the first time, to familiarize yourself with the interface and building without excessive pressure
- Choose the Northern Forest if you are looking for a challenge focused on fast optimization and abundant pure ores
- Save your world state before attempting a complete relocation of your production structures
